Unlike standard wrenches, impact wrenches utilize a hammering mechanism to generate bursts of rotational force. This percussive action is what allows them to overcome resistance that would otherwise require immense manual effort or risk damaging the fastener. The 1/2 inch drive size is the most common and versatile for a wide range of automotive applications, balancing power delivery with accessibility to various sockets.

Key Features to Evaluate

Before diving into specific models, it's imperative to acknowledge the core components and functions that define a quality 1/2 inch high torque impact wrench. This includes the motor, hammer mechanism, gearbox, and battery (for cordless models) or air inlet (for pneumatic). The quality of these parts directly impacts the tool's lifespan and its ability to perform under pressure.

For instance, the hammer mechanism design can affect the smoothness and efficiency of the torque delivery. Some employ single-hammer designs, while others use twin-hammer systems, which generally offer more balanced power and are preferred for their durability and ability to deliver more consistent torque.

The ergonomics of the grip and the tool's weight distribution are also vital for user comfort, especially during extended use. A well-balanced tool reduces fatigue, allowing you to maintain control and precision.

Choosing Your Power Source: Cordless, Pneumatic, or Electric?

What is the best power source for your needs? The choice between cordless, pneumatic, and corded electric 1/2 inch high torque impact wrenches depends heavily on your typical work environment and required mobility. Each offers distinct advantages and disadvantages that impact usability and performance.

Cordless impact wrenches have surged in popularity due to their unparalleled portability and freedom from air hoses or power cords. Modern lithium-ion battery technology provides ample power for most automotive tasks, often rivaling pneumatic counterparts. Look for high voltage (18V or 20V) and high Amp-hour (Ah) ratings for extended runtimes and consistent torque delivery. The primary drawback can be battery life during extremely demanding, continuous use, and the initial investment in batteries and chargers.

Pneumatic impact wrenches have long been the standard in professional garages for their raw power and durability. They require a robust air compressor to operate, meaning a fixed location or significant setup time. Their main benefits are their lighter weight (compared to equivalent cordless models) and the consistent, high torque they can deliver without worrying about battery depletion. However, they demand a continuous supply of clean, dry air, which necessitates air filters and regulators, adding complexity and cost.

Corded electric impact wrenches offer a middle ground, providing consistent power without the need for batteries or air compressors. They are generally less powerful than high-end pneumatic or cordless models and tether you to an outlet, limiting mobility. They are often a more budget-friendly option for home mechanics who don't need extreme portability.

Top Considerations for Performance and Longevity

Beyond power source, what specific attributes distinguish a top-performing 1/2 inch high torque impact wrench? Several factors directly influence its practical utility, from torque settings to brushless motors and durability features.

Torque Specifications: Look for a wrench with a torque rating that comfortably exceeds your typical needs. While manufacturers often list peak torque (breakaway torque), consider the working torque as well. For automotive work, 300-600 ft-lbs is common, with heavy-duty applications potentially requiring 800+ ft-lbs. Ensure the tool has variable speed and torque settings for finer control when needed, preventing overtightening or damage to delicate components.

Motor Type: Brushless motors are becoming standard in high-end cordless tools. They offer increased efficiency, longer runtimes, more power, and greater durability than brushed motors, as they have fewer moving parts to wear out. This is a significant advantage for professionals who rely on their tools daily.

Durability and Construction: A robust housing, often made from reinforced composite materials or metal, is crucial. Look for features like rubber overmolds to protect against drops and impacts. The anvil (where the socket attaches) should be hardened steel for maximum lifespan. For pneumatic tools, ensure the housing is designed to withstand vibration and impact.

Ergonomics and Weight: A tool that feels comfortable and balanced in your hand reduces fatigue. Consider the weight, especially if you'll be working overhead or in tight spaces for extended periods. Some wrenches include auxiliary handles for better leverage and control.

Maintenance: Regular maintenance is key. For pneumatic tools, this means oiling the air motor daily and ensuring the air supply is clean and dry. Cordless tools require keeping batteries charged and clean. Periodically inspect the anvil and impact mechanism for wear or damage. Understanding this maintenance is fundamental.
